cubierta
Esta oferta ya no está disponible

Senior Software Engineer en Barcelona

Magento

Lugar de trabajo
En sede
Horas
Full-Time
Prácticas
false
Comparte la oferta

Descripción de la oferta

Adobe/Magento believes in hiring the very best. We are known for our vibrant, dynamic and rewarding workplace where personal and professional fulfillment and company success go hand in hand. We take pride in creating exceptional work experiences, encouraging innovation and being involved with our employees, customers and communities. We invite you to discover what makes Adobe such a great place to work.

Click this link to experience A Day in the Life at Adobe: http://www.adobe.com/aboutadobe/careeropp/fma/dayinthelife/

Position Summary:

Adobe/Magento's Barcelona Engineering team is looking for a Software Engineer to help us make future releases of Magento the best they can be. If you are an expert software engineer who wants to stretch your knowledge, forge a lean DevOps oriented culture, and drive your career forward, we want to hear from YOU!


Key Responsibilities:


  • Develop deep product refactoring and feature gap solutions and bug fixes in a large and active open source PHP code base
  • Develop Production-level high quality code covered with appropriate automated tests
  • Develop and maintain technical documentation related to the project
  • Actively participate in architectural discussions and propose solutions to system and product changes cross teams
  • Identify and review backward incompatibility changes and mitigate impact on customers
  • Mentor and coach other engineers on the team
  • Independently chase complex tasks and dependencies to completion
  • Participate in peer code reviews
  • Participate fully in and sometimes lead agile team activities


Professional Experience/Qualifications:

  • 4+ years’ Production-level experience with PHP, Java, and/or Javascript
  • Production experience with an interpreted language a plus
  • Experience with app level caching (Redis, ElasticSearch) a plus
  • Understanding of web application architecture
  • Deep understanding of Object Oriented principles and design patterns
  • Experience with frameworks such as Zend, Prototype(JS), and JQuery(JS)
  • Knowledge with relational databases (MySQL)
  • Knowledge of test automation processes and tools such as Selenium and PHPUnit
  • Experience with CI/CD pipeline fundamentals and tools such as Jenkins
  • Experience with git, GitHub
  • Experience in UNIX systems on a user level
  • Familiarity with Lean/Kanban processes preferred
  • Bachelor’s Degree, Master's Degree, or equivalent



At Adobe, you will be immersed in an exceptional work environment that is recognized throughout the world on Best Companies lists. You will also be surrounded by colleagues who are committed to helping each other grow through our unique Check-In approach where ongoing feedback flows freely.


If you’re looking to make an impact, Adobe's the place for you. Discover what our employees are saying about their career experiences on the Adobe Life blog and explore the meaningful benefits we offer.


Adobe is an equal opportunity employer. We welcome and encourage diversity in the workplace regardless of race, gender, religion, age, sexual orientation, gender identity, disability or veteran status.

 

Acerca de Magento

  • Ecommerce

Magento la página de empresa está vacía
Añade descripción e imágenes para atraer más candiadatos y aumentar el Employer Branding.

Otras ofertas de ingeniero de software que podrían interesarte...